BLS Issues Report on State Employment and Unemployment - August 2025
WASHINGTON, Sept. 20 (TNSLrpt) -- The U.S. Department of Labor's Bureau of Labor Statistics issued the following report (No. USDL-25-1407) on Sept. 19, 2025, entitled "State Employment and Unemployment - August 2025": * * * Unemployment rates were higher in August in 3 states, lower in 2 states, and stable in 45 states and the District of Columbia, the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ics reported today.
